正しさと効率の形式的証明を備えたスケルトン並列プログラミング環境に関する研究
具有正确性和效率形式化证明的骨架并行编程环境的研究
基本信息
- 批准号:19K11903
- 负责人:
- 金额:$ 2.75万
- 依托单位:
- 依托单位国家:日本
- 项目类别:Grant-in-Aid for Scientific Research (C)
- 财政年份:2019
- 资助国家:日本
- 起止时间:2019-04-01 至 2024-03-31
- 项目状态:已结题
- 来源:
- 关键词:
项目摘要
今年度は、大きくふたつの観点で研究を進めた。ひとつ目の観点として、まず、BSP モデルに基づく並列スケルトンの組み合わせにコンパイル可能な大規模グラフ計算記述言語について、その記述性向上のための拡張を行った。この言語は、頂点集合変数を用いた並列性を意識しない大域的視点でのグラフ計算記述を可能とする言語として設計されたものであり、今回、辺集合変数の導入と通信削減等のコンパイル時最適化の導入を行った。これにより、辺集合を用いて記述されるマッチングアルゴリズムなどの並列プログラムを、並列性を意識せずに自然に記述できるようになった。また、命令の順序入れ替えによるスーパーステップ数の削減や自明な冗長通信の削除等の最適化を導入し、コンパイル後の並列プログラムの実行性能の向上を行った。この成果については国内ワークショップでの発表を行った。もうひとつの観点として、昨年度の研究により明らかになった「並列プログラムの証明の手間がかかりすぎる」という問題点に対し、その証明の手間を軽減するための手法の開発を開始した。整数算術などの特定分野については自動証明タクティックが存在するものの、「並列プログラムの(計算量)証明」については新たな手法の開発が必要となる。基本的なアプローチとして深層学習による部分的証明の自動生成を考え、深層学習に基づく証明全体の自動生成に関する既存研究の調査してその学習モデルの拡張に着手した。
This year, there has been a lot of progress in the study of this year's research. In this paper, we need to click on the key points of the system, such as, BSP, and list the data of the system. It is possible to perform large-scale calculation, record the data, and improve the performance of the system. The number of data sets and data points is used to calculate the number of data points in a wide range of information systems. It is possible to record the number of data points. This time, the number of data sets is the most efficient way to enter the database, such as communication clips and so on. In this paper, we use the words to record the information, the collection, the collection and the parallelism. The order of information and command is in the order of the number of users. It is clear that long-term communications are deleted, and the performance of the system is listed in order to improve the performance. The results show that there are many problems in the country. In the last year of the study, there is a list of information about mobile phones, mobile phones and mobile phones. In the field of integer arithmetic, it is necessary to automatically verify that there is a system in the system, and list the information (calculated quantity) to indicate that the new method is necessary. In the part of the basic training program, there is an examination of the automatic generation of knowledge and knowledge, and the basis of the basic knowledge of learning is that all the existing research programs of automatic generation of students begin to learn.
项目成果
期刊论文数量(8)
专著数量(0)
科研奖励数量(0)
会议论文数量(0)
专利数量(0)
Distributed parallel generation of large-scale random graphs based on Watts–Strogatz model
基于Watts-Strogatz模型的大规模随机图分布式并行生成
- DOI:10.11309/jssst.37.2_34
- 发表时间:2020
- 期刊:
- 影响因子:0
- 作者:神野 薫;江本 健斗
- 通讯作者:江本 健斗
Watts-Strogatz モデルに基づく大規模ランダムグラフの分散並列生成
基于Watts-Strogatz模型的大规模随机图分布式并行生成
- DOI:
- 发表时间:2019
- 期刊:
- 影响因子:0
- 作者:神野 薫;江本 健斗
- 通讯作者:江本 健斗
並列計算量の形式的証明を伴う BSP プログラム用 Coq ライブラリ
用于 BSP 程序的 Coq 库,具有并行复杂性的形式证明
- DOI:
- 发表时间:2022
- 期刊:
- 影响因子:0
- 作者:田中 匠海;江本 健斗
- 通讯作者:江本 健斗
Coq における Hylomorphism を用いたプログラム運算の検証に向けて
在 Coq 中使用 Hylomorphism 验证程序操作
- DOI:
- 发表时间:2020
- 期刊:
- 影响因子:0
- 作者:村田 康佑;江本 健斗
- 通讯作者:江本 健斗
{{
item.title }}
{{ item.translation_title }}
- DOI:
{{ item.doi }} - 发表时间:
{{ item.publish_year }} - 期刊:
- 影响因子:{{ item.factor }}
- 作者:
{{ item.authors }} - 通讯作者:
{{ item.author }}
数据更新时间:{{ journalArticles.updateTime }}
{{ item.title }}
- 作者:
{{ item.author }}
数据更新时间:{{ monograph.updateTime }}
{{ item.title }}
- 作者:
{{ item.author }}
数据更新时间:{{ sciAawards.updateTime }}
{{ item.title }}
- 作者:
{{ item.author }}
数据更新时间:{{ conferencePapers.updateTime }}
{{ item.title }}
- 作者:
{{ item.author }}
数据更新时间:{{ patent.updateTime }}
江本 健斗其他文献
ホケルトンによるXPathクエリの並列化とその評価
使用 Hokelton 的 XPath 查询并行化及其评估
- DOI:
- 发表时间:
2007 - 期刊:
- 影响因子:0
- 作者:
野村 芳明;江本 健斗;松崎 公紀;胡 振江;武市 正人 - 通讯作者:
武市 正人
江本 健斗的其他文献
{{
item.title }}
{{ item.translation_title }}
- DOI:
{{ item.doi }} - 发表时间:
{{ item.publish_year }} - 期刊:
- 影响因子:{{ item.factor }}
- 作者:
{{ item.authors }} - 通讯作者:
{{ item.author }}
{{ truncateString('江本 健斗', 18)}}的其他基金
正しさと効率の保証を備えた平易な並列プログラミング環境の構築に関する研究
构建简单且保证正确性和高效性的并行编程环境的研究
- 批准号:
24K14898 - 财政年份:2024
- 资助金额:
$ 2.75万 - 项目类别:
Grant-in-Aid for Scientific Research (C)
相似海外基金
An autonomous machine learning-based molecular dynamics method that utilizes first-principles atomic energy calculation
一种基于自主机器学习的分子动力学方法,利用第一原理原子能计算
- 批准号:
23H03415 - 财政年份:2023
- 资助金额:
$ 2.75万 - 项目类别:
Grant-in-Aid for Scientific Research (B)
Understanding moisture-induced adhesion weakening via first-principles protonation calculation
通过第一原理质子化计算了解水分引起的粘附减弱
- 批准号:
23H01697 - 财政年份:2023
- 资助金额:
$ 2.75万 - 项目类别:
Grant-in-Aid for Scientific Research (B)
Development of calculation method for Magnetophonics and its application to magnetic materials
磁声学计算方法的发展及其在磁性材料中的应用
- 批准号:
23KJ2165 - 财政年份:2023
- 资助金额:
$ 2.75万 - 项目类别:
Grant-in-Aid for JSPS Fellows
A new nuclear matter calculation method based on realistic nuclear forces and the effect of many-body terms on the equation of state
基于现实核力和多体项对状态方程影响的新核物质计算方法
- 批准号:
23K03397 - 财政年份:2023
- 资助金额:
$ 2.75万 - 项目类别:
Grant-in-Aid for Scientific Research (C)
非従来型超伝導に対する第一原理手法の開発
非常规超导第一性原理方法的发展
- 批准号:
22KJ0958 - 财政年份:2023
- 资助金额:
$ 2.75万 - 项目类别:
Grant-in-Aid for JSPS Fellows
Calculation and the Verification of the maximum electric power of Microbial Fuel Cells by Minimizing the Internal Resistance Using the Mathematical Model
微生物燃料电池内阻最小化最大电功率的数学模型计算与验证
- 批准号:
23K11483 - 财政年份:2023
- 资助金额:
$ 2.75万 - 项目类别:
Grant-in-Aid for Scientific Research (C)
Applying Innovative Artificial Intelligence Approaches to a Large Sleep Physiologic Biorepository to Integrate Sleep Disruption in Cardiovascular Risk Calculation
将创新的人工智能方法应用于大型睡眠生理生物库,将睡眠中断纳入心血管风险计算
- 批准号:
10731500 - 财政年份:2023
- 资助金额:
$ 2.75万 - 项目类别:
有機リン化合物を活用した触媒および合成反応の開発
使用有机磷化合物的催化剂和合成反应的开发
- 批准号:
22KJ0075 - 财政年份:2023
- 资助金额:
$ 2.75万 - 项目类别:
Grant-in-Aid for JSPS Fellows
RUI: Calculation of Higher Order Corrections to Positronium Energy Levels
RUI:正电子能级高阶修正的计算
- 批准号:
2308792 - 财政年份:2023
- 资助金额:
$ 2.75万 - 项目类别:
Standard Grant
What causes misconduct: Does inter-corporate competition skew the calculation of benefits and costs?
导致不当行为的原因:公司间竞争是否会扭曲收益和成本的计算?
- 批准号:
23K01362 - 财政年份:2023
- 资助金额:
$ 2.75万 - 项目类别:
Grant-in-Aid for Scientific Research (C)